Le 24/02/2016 19:55, Stephane Boireau a écrit :
Le 24/02/2016 18:41, pascal.dieudonne a écrit :
J'ai oublié : version mysql 5.7.9
J'ai trouvé la page que tu m'as indiquée et je retrouve des infos sur le
no zero date dans ce fichier, mais je ne sais pas s'il faut modifier
quelque chose.
Moi, j'enlèverais
NO_ZERO_DATE,NO_ZERO_IN_DATE,
et je relancerais mysql.
bonjour,
Je confirme.
Le problème vient du fait que Wampserver 3.0 comporte la ligne de
configuration
sql-mode="STRICT_ALL_TABLES,ERROR_FOR_DIVISION_BY_ZERO,NO_ZERO_DATE,NO_ZERO_IN_DATE,NO_AUTO_CREATE_USER"
et "NO_ZERO_DATE,NO_ZERO_IN_DATE" est incompatible avec une date de type
"0000-00-00".
On peut contourner le souci provisoirement :
- en installant Wampserver 2.5 qui ne contient pas cette directive bloquante
- en modifiant le fichier my.ini de MySQL pour retirer
"NO_ZERO_DATE,NO_ZERO_IN_DATE"
Pour une correction durable, l'idéal serait de changer la définition des
champs concernés en remplaçant
NOT NULL default '0000-00-00 00:00:00'
et
NOT NULL default '0000-00-00'
par
default NULL
mais il faut vérifier que le reste du code est compatible...
Amicalement,
--
Thomas Crespin
_________________________________________________________________________________
Documentation Gepi en ligne : http://www.sylogix.org/projects/gepi/wiki
Pour modifier ou rsilier votre abonnement cette liste :
https://lists.sylogix.net/mailman/listinfo/gepi-users